Difference between revisions of "Psychonauts"

From FEX-Emu Wiki
Jump to navigation Jump to search
(updating test entry with experimental templates (adds CPU and GPU columns))
 
Line 25: Line 25:
 
<!-- {{testing/entry|revision=|archtitle=|archhost=|result=|tester=}} -->
 
<!-- {{testing/entry|revision=|archtitle=|archhost=|result=|tester=}} -->
  
{{testing/start}}
+
{{Dan/testing/start}}
{{testing/entry|revision=FEX-2211|archtitle=x86-32|archhost=AArch64|result=Quite slow. Might be due to GPU thread on primary.|Runstester=Sonicadvance1}}
+
{{Dan/Testing/entry|revision=FEX-2211|archtitle=x86-32|archhost=AArch64|SoC=Snapdragon 888|GPU=Adreno 660|result=Quite slow. Might be due to GPU thread on primary.|Runstester=Sonicadvance1}}
 
{{testing/end}}
 
{{testing/end}}

Latest revision as of 08:45, 18 February 2024

Psychonauts
library_600x900.jpg


Storefronts

Steam logo.svg

Operating Systems Linux
Architecture x86-32
CPU Features Used Unknown
Compatibility Playable
Type Game
Render API OpenGL

Steps to Run

No special instructions

Quirks

Linux Native version slower than Proton

The Linux native port of the game stripped out all SSE optimizations and falls back to x87 implementations. This hits FEX's x87 softfloat emulation quite hard and causes the game to run slow.

Force the Proton/Windows version instead to get the SSE optimized codepath and the game runs quite a bit faster.

Problems/Workarounds

Testing Results

This title has been tested on the environments listed below:

Test Entries
Revision Arch of Title Arch of Host SoC GPU Result Tester
FEX-2211 x86-32 AArch64 Snapdragon 888 Adreno 660 Quite slow. Might be due to GPU thread on primary.